Power and Speed Performance

The DCG426B die grinder's variable speed capability is reported to range from 8,000 to 25,000 RPM with excellent torque maintenance throughout the range according to independent testing. This performance characteristic is known to enable precise material removal rates while preventing the overheating that can occur with fixed-speed tools operating at inappropriate speeds for specific materials.

Speed Control Benefits

  • Low speeds (8,000-12,000 RPM): Ideal for soft woods and delicate detail work according to our research
  • Medium speeds (12,000-18,000 RPM): Reported to work well for general carving and shaping applications
  • High speeds (18,000-25,000 RPM): Best for hardwoods and aggressive material removal based on user feedback
  • Variable control: Enables real-time adjustment without stopping work according to independent reviews

Detail Carving and Relief Work

The DCG426B's variable speed control is reported to provide exceptional control for intricate detail work where material removal rates must be precisely managed according to independent reviews. Lower speeds (8,000-12,000 RPM) are known to prevent tear-out in cross-grain situations while higher speeds enable efficient waste removal in areas requiring aggressive material removal based on user feedback.

💡 Detail Carving Techniques

  • Start with lower speeds when establishing initial cuts to maintain precise control
  • Gradually increase speed as material removal requirements increase
  • Use light pressure and let the tool do the work to prevent burning or chatter
  • Sharp burrs and bits are reported to provide better results than attempting to compensate with higher speeds

Die Grinder Accessories

DeWalt die grinder accessories utilize standard 1/8-inch collet systems that are reported to accept most universal rotary tool attachments according to manufacturer specifications. This compatibility is known to provide access to extensive accessory selections from multiple manufacturers while maintaining the precision and safety that professional applications demand.

Compatible Accessory Types

  • Cutting discs: Metal and ceramic options for various material applications
  • Grinding stones: Multiple grits and shapes for material removal and shaping
  • Carbide burrs: Professional-grade options for aggressive material removal
  • Sanding drums: Various grits for surface preparation and finishing
  • Wire brushes: Steel and brass options for cleaning and surface preparation
  • Polishing wheels: Felt and cotton wheels for final finishing applications

Battery Maintenance

20V Max battery maintenance involves procedures that maximize lifespan while ensuring consistent performance delivery. Lithium-ion technology requires specific care practices that differ from older battery chemistries and significantly impact long-term value and reliability.

💡 Battery Care Best Practices

  • Store batteries at partial charge (30-50%) for extended periods according to guidelines
  • Avoid complete discharge cycles which can reduce overall battery capacity
  • Keep contacts clean using dry cloth or light abrasive if corrosion develops
  • Store in temperature-controlled environment away from extreme heat or cold
  • Rotate between multiple batteries to ensure even usage and aging patterns

Asaya - Traditional Woodcarver

About Asaya

Traditional Woodcarver | Inami, Japan

Born into an academic family in Germany, Asaya traded physics equations for chisels and wood—a decision that led him across continents in pursuit of traditional craftsmanship. After teaching himself the basics, he spent a year learning in Sweden, followed by intensive study under local artisans in Oaxaca, Mexico. Since early 2024, he has been living in Inami, Japan—the historic center of Japanese woodcarving—where he became the first European apprentice accepted by the town's master carvers.

Through his work, Asaya is dedicated to preserving endangered woodcarving traditions from around the world. By studying directly under masters and documenting their techniques, he helps ensure these ancient skills survive for future generations. His sculptures serve as cultural bridges—honoring the heritage of each tradition while creating contemporary pieces that keep these time-honored crafts alive and relevant in the modern world.
